Job Description

The Auto Club Group (ACG) provides membership, travel, insurance and financial services offerings to approximately 9 million members and customers across 11 states and 2 U.S. territories through the AAA, Meemic and Fremont brands. ACG belongs to the national AAA federation and is the second largest AAA club in North America.

Primary Duties and Responsibilities:

Serves as a team member on a system testing team that works with one or more business/development units on small to large software projects. Analyzes business requirements, identifies test conditions and develops test cases with expected results that are approved by respective business units. Executes manual and automated test cases, validates results and provides accountability t business units for accuracy and thoroughness of system testing and software certification tasks. Coordinates functional testing efforts with project team and develops work plan estimates for moderately complex tasks to ensure work efforts are accomplished within time estimates. Identifies and documents defects in compliance with established procedures.
